Output 63cfc848eb3debf87a1849c5f6829da1827862d4bbde2f232298ad7ec636b12a:1

value
20516720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524af9116bd112eb3a507e9543af734df6640219 OP_EQUAL
address
MFQHTNRiLAHXLNX9dvPfWtGgEoBuZvx4Vo
transaction
63cfc848eb3debf87a1849c5f6829da1827862d4bbde2f232298ad7ec636b12a
spent
true